The Central Florida Knights are 0-11 so far on the season, and 2-9 ATS vs the point spread. The South Florida Bulls, meanwhile, are 7-4 and 8-2-1 ATS. Those over under betting have seen Central Florida go 5-5-1 and the South Florida Bulls go 6-5 on the totals. Statistical Matchup
Offensively, the game matches up the Central Florida Knights No. 125-ranked offense (14.91 PPG) against a South Florida Bulls defense that ranks No. 40 at 22.73 PPG. The Central Florida Knights passing attack has averaged 194 yards per game, less than the South Florida Bulls give up through the air (230.09 YPG on average).

Recent Outings Betting Recap
Marlon Mack ran through the Cincinnati defense for 106 yards in South Florida's last game, handing the Bearcats a 65-27 setback on Friday at Raymond James Stadium.
Central Florida didn't make much of a game of it last time out, losing to the Pirates as East Carolina blasted them 44-7 in Week 12 action.
